Data from external modules is gathered onto the logger and relayed to the internet of things via the display's WiFi. It has a touch sensitive LCD screen.\u003c\/p\u003e\n\u003c\/div\u003e\n\u003cdiv class=\"w3-panel\"\u003e\n\u003cp\u003eDisplay features include:\u003c\/p\u003e\n\u003cul\u003e\n\u003cli\u003e3.5\" Colour Touch LCD to display information about the system\u003c\/li\u003e\n\u003cli\u003eWiFi to communicate with the IoT (internet of things)\u003c\/li\u003e\n\u003cli\u003eMemory enough to store 6 months worth of data\u003c\/li\u003e\n\u003cli\u003eMicro logger with 6 inputs (4 Analog, 2 Digital)\u003c\/li\u003e\n\u003cli\u003eUSB Host to export data in Excell format directly to FLASH Drive\u003c\/li\u003e\n\u003cli\u003eBattery enough to power the logger and display for 12 hours\u003c\/li\u003e\n\u003c\/ul\u003e\n\u003cp\u003eThe display allows the user to both read current and stored information as well as to control the system.\u003c\/p\u003e\n\u003cp\u003eThere are two built-in timers which allow the user to set time periods when AC Grid power will be made available to the system.\u003c\/p\u003e\n\u003cp\u003eFurther, it allows independent setting of heating temperatures for both AC and Solar power within these windows.\u003c\/p\u003e\n\u003cp\u003eIt also allows the user to see the temperature of the water in the geyser, both current temperature and stored data.\u003c\/p\u003e\n\u003cp\u003eSolar production data, both instantaneous and historical, can be viewed on the monitor.\u003c\/p\u003e\n\u003cp\u003eThere is also an override function which will force AC current to the geyser for a set period, if required.\u003c\/p\u003e\n\u003cp\u003eFor the WiFi equipped model, all these functions can be performed and data viewed by logging into an online application on a desktop or mobile device.\u003c\/p\u003e\n\u003c\/div\u003e\n\u003cdiv class=\"w3-panel\"\u003e\n\u003ch2\u003eWiFi\u003c\/h2\u003e\n\u003cp\u003eThe display can connect to a 2.4Ghz WiFi networks to send data to a central server from where the Cellphone app can access data even when the user is not at home. The WiFi can be disabled when not required.\u003c\/p\u003e\n\u003cp\u003eThe WiFi connection is safe to use on a mobile hot spot as it uses very little data.\u003c\/p\u003e\n\u003c\/div\u003e\n\u003cdiv class=\"w3-panel\"\u003e\n\u003ch2\u003eOnline application\u003c\/h2\u003e\n\u003cp\u003eThe online app allows users to monitor multiple installations simultaneously.\u003c\/p\u003e\n\u003c\/div\u003e\n\u003cdiv class=\"w3-panel\"\u003e\n\u003ch2\u003eMemory\u003c\/h2\u003e\n\u003cp\u003eData are stored on the 16MByte embedded FLASH memory and sent through to the server when WiFi is available. When no WiFi is available, all data is timestamped and stored onto the FLASH. When no WiFi is available, Logger time and date needs to be set in the menu. When WiFi is available, time and date is automatically synchronized with international time servers for accuracy. Data can alternatively be downloaded via USB onto a flashdrive.\u003c\/p\u003e\n\u003c\/div\u003e\n\u003cdiv class=\"w3-panel\"\u003e\n\u003ch2\u003eMicro logger\u003c\/h2\u003e\n\u003cp\u003eThe Logger can take four analog inputs, which can be used to measure circuit breakers in the distribution board (DB). Although any 3rd party 3.3V Arduino current sensor should also work on our system, we cannot test all 3rd party sensors to give a comprehensive list.\u003c\/p\u003e\n\u003cp\u003eWe offer a standard in-line type 20Amp sensor for most projects, but other capacity sensors are also available. We use a generic 3.3Volt allegro hall effect sensor commonly found inside Arduino modules. Efergy split core CT's are also available, although they are too large for most installations.\u003c\/p\u003e\n\u003cp\u003eSensors are probed continously and a true RMS value calculated and averaged over the 5min interval until the measurement is timestamed and saved onto FLASH memory.\u003c\/p\u003e\n\u003cp\u003eThe Logger can also take two pulse inputs, which can be connected to water or power meters that support pulse output. Most elster water meters and elster power meters give out pulses when a set unit of measure is counted (optional probes may be required from the meter manufacturer).\u003c\/p\u003e\n\u003cp\u003eThe Logger can also communicate with external devices over a High speed RS485 network to expand capabilities. The Logger can communicate with the Pi²R Smart and the Inverter in this manner.\u003c\/p\u003e\n\u003c\/div\u003e\n\u003cdiv class=\"w3-panel\"\u003e\n\u003ch2\u003eUSB Host\u003c\/h2\u003e\n\u003cp\u003eThe Logger can interface with a USB 2.0 Full speed device. We have built-in drivers to handle the generic MSD type FLASH drives with FAT filesystem. Currently other filesystems do not work with our embedded drivers.\u003c\/p\u003e\n\u003cp\u003eData can be exported to Excell CVS files to visualize your data on any spreadsheet editor.\u003c\/p\u003e\n\u003c\/div\u003e\n\u003cdiv class=\"w3-panel\"\u003e\n\u003ch2\u003eBattery\u003c\/h2\u003e\n\u003cp\u003eFor normal installations we supply a 1100mAh battery standard. External sensors can use a significant amount of power and will drain the battery faster. The LCD backlight can also draw a considerable amount of power and shorten battery life. Althoug the sensors and LCD can drain the battery fast, it should easily last through even the longest loadshedding.\u003c\/p\u003e\n\u003cp\u003eFor Off-grid installations there is an optional 2200mAh battery available for extended service when no power is available.\u003c\/p\u003e\n\u003c\/div\u003e\n\u003cdiv class=\"w3-panel\"\u003e\n\u003cbr\u003e\n\u003ch2\u003eDisplay modes\u003c\/h2\u003e\n\u003cp\u003eThere are multiple modes of operation.
